This is an original Chris Reeve 7" Mark V South Africa made knife, serial number 62. It appears as new, unsharpened, and the only blemishes appear to be handling, and storage marks (see photos). The engraved marking "South Africa" makes this a special knife...but..wait...there is nothing I can tell you about it that Anne Reeve can't say better in an email she sent me about it. So here it is:
The model name is MK V (roman numeral for 5). Number 62 Mk V was made in May/June 1987. The South Africa engraving was prompted by a previous shipment to the USA being stopped at customs because no country of origin was marked on any of the knives. We subsequently had a stamp made that indicated "Made in RSA" but the engraving as on your knife was a stop gap solution. The knife is made of A2 tool steel, Heat treated to 55-57RC, the butt cap is D65S Aluminum - or as we could have called it is SA, aluminium! The coating is KG GunKote (TM).
